Team member's are the most valuable asset to an organisation.  Managers could chalk up the best strategy and fail if they dont know how to lead their workers. The term "employees don't leave the company,  they leave their managers", is very true. A manager may do everthing thats in their job description,  but if its not done earnestly, then nothing they do matters. Give credit to eachvteam member for the work they did regularly, observe their body language and look for negatives.  If they are down, have a one on one with them, find out if there's something troubling them. Loose the old method of showing the show off star his/her place by slamming them down every chance you get infront of others Taken the team out and play healthy team games with them and if there is friction among team mates, help remove them completely.  Do a positive team meeting at the start of every day and a feed back at the end of the day not the other way around. Remember, managers were team members and still are. They win, managers win! So forget your ego, but dont forget your position.
